--- Comment #1 from Nicolas Frattaroli <kdeb...@fratti.ch> --- I've just tried connecting my laptop to the TV again. Everything went a bit crazy. The taskbar disappeared, even though my laptop display was set as the primary output. Plasma ended up crashing (sadly I could not get a crashdump), and I had to reboot the system after disconnecting it from the external TV to even get working compositing again, as windows did not refresh and the background was replaced with black. I've found some files of interest in my .local and .config: 1. Three files in .local/share/kscreen, which seem to list (in a duplicate manner) configured screens. Here they are, tarred and gzipped: https://fratti.ch/bugdemos/kscreen/kscreen.tar.gz 2. The following lines in .config/plasmashellrc: [PlasmaViews][Panel 1][Horizontal1920] length=3779 thickness=30 [PlasmaViews][Panel 16][Horizontal1920] thickness=36 I'm assuming my original panel, Panel 1, still exists *somewhere*, just not on any physical screens. Panel 16 seems to be the one I'm currently using and have created after I've encountered the bug, as it is indeed thicker.
